Octopus latches onto 6-year-old boy, refusing to release, mother says, showing footage of the child's injuries
Share this @internewscast.com

A 6-year-old boy was left with welts on his arm after an octopus latched onto him. His mother, Britney Taryn, recounted the alarming experience at a Texas aquarium in a widely viewed social media video on TikTok.

Taryn included video footage showing the marks dotting the length of her son’s arm all the way up to his armpit.

She mentioned in the video that her son regularly visits the octopus at the San Antonio Aquarium. He is permitted to touch the animal, and typically, it suctions onto her son and then lets go.

“We want to emphasize that our giant Pacific octopus is a healthy, well-cared-for animal thriving in its environment and does not display harmful behavior toward guests or staff. Octopuses are highly intelligent and curious beings, and their interactions with humans are often playful and exploratory.

“However, as with any animal encounter, there are inherent risks, which is why we have strict protocols in place to ensure safety for all.”
